After the first artistic residency, in March, with the Austrian Andreas Trobollowitsch, the Fontes Sonoras project continues in May with a new residency dedicated to listening and sound creation.
This time, artists Inês Tartaruga Água and Xavier Paes will be responsible for exploring the territory of Aldeia das Fontes, in Leiria, and its unique landscape as a creative source for a new work of sound art.
For around 10 days, the artist duo will reside in the village and dedicate themselves to listening to the place, in dialogue with its landscape and local community, to create a new self-generating sound piece. The artists propose to work with natural elements — such as the flow of the Liz River, the breath of the wind or the movement of the leaves on the trees — in a process of co-creation in which the landscape is more than a setting, also becoming a sound and performative body, whose rhythms and forces determine the execution of the work itself.
The creative process will be based on the idea of “controlled improvisation”, where artists define the parameters — such as tunings, materials and structures — but the execution of the work will be governed by the natural dynamics of the location. For example, the flow and speed of the river will directly influence the rhythm and tempo of the composition, a sound experience that will evolve in an unpredictable and unique way.
In addition to providing artists with the opportunity to experiment and develop new works, the Fontes Sonoras project aims to bring sound art to the Fontes community, expanding the artistic horizon of the village, which is naturally far removed from these practices in its daily life. It is an enriching exchange, where both artists and the community are involved in a creative process that leaves the final result open.
The residency will culminate with a public presentation on May 11, where the public will be invited to experience this new creation by Inês Tartaruga Água and Xavier Paes. It will be an opportunity to reflect on the relationship between humans and the forces of nature, encouraging active listening and providing space for the exploratory creation of new sounds.
Fontes Sonoras is an initiative by Omnichord, curated by Raquel Castro and artistic direction by Gui Garrido. The third residency, which will complete the first edition of Fontes Sonoras, will take place in October this year and will be announced soon.
About the Artists
Inês Tartaruga Água and Xavier Paes are visual artists whose practice lies at the intersection of performance, sound and image. They have collaborated regularly since 2015, exploring ecological phenomena and their resonant bodies. Advocates of collaborative and participatory practices, the artists are enthusiasts of radical regeneration and sound explorers, with a DIY approach, marked by improvisation and activism.
His work is marked by a multidisciplinary practice and has been presented in spaces such as Cafe Oto, Villa Arson, STUK Arts Centre, Fundação de Serralves, Galeria Zé dos Bois, among others.
